Flooring Installation cost breakdown in Minneapolis

Flooring is priced per square foot, which makes it one of the easier trades to review — if you know the typical material and labor rates for your area. Material grade and labor rate are the two numbers to confirm.

The ranges below assume a typical mid-range project — standard scope, mid-grade materials, and normal site conditions, with the existing layout largely retained. Structural changes, premium materials, or difficult access can push a legitimate quote above these figures.

Line itemModeled Minneapolis range
Removal of old flooring$500$1,600
Subfloor prep & leveling$400$1,600
Material (hardwood / LVP / tile)$2,600$6,500
Installation labor$1,700$4,300
Trim & transitions$300$1,000
Disposal$200$600
Total project range$3,200$13,000

Modeled ranges based on national construction-cost data adjusted for Minneapolis-area labor rates. Your exact cost depends on materials, scope, site conditions, and contractor.

Pricing context in Minneapolis

A shorter seasonal building window and Midwest labor rates put Minneapolis costs slightly above average. For flooring installation, that puts Minneapolis about 8% above the national average.

Minneapolis has moderate construction labor costs — skilled trades here typically run $45–$75/hr. A typical flooring project in Minneapolis often lands near $8,100, with line items roughly matching the modeled ranges above.

If a line item sits meaningfully above the modeled range, that's a reason to ask what's driving it — qualified labor, permits, site conditions, or material grade may fully explain the difference. It's a question to raise, not a conclusion.

How much does flooring installation cost per square foot?

Installation labor typically runs $3–$8 per square foot nationally for standard work, plus material. Tile and intricate patterns cost more than plank flooring.

Is luxury vinyl cheaper than hardwood?

Yes. Luxury vinyl plank (LVP) is generally cheaper than solid hardwood in both material and labor, and is more water-resistant, which is why it has become so popular.

Should the quote include old flooring removal?

It should be a clearly listed line. If removal and disposal are missing or bundled vaguely, ask for them to be itemized.
